Job SummaryGeorgia Gwinnett College is now accepting applications for part-time faculty positions in Religion in the School of Liberal Arts for the academic year ). The posting will remain active for AY25-26 hiring (Fall, Spring, and Summer). Part-Time faculty positions are semester-based, report to the Department Chair, and may be conducted in face-to-face, online, hybrid, or blended formats. Positions are on an as-needed basis and may require additional time outside of class for student feedback and meetings.
Classes are offered in the fall, spring, and/or summer with morning, afternoon, evening, and weekend offerings.
A minimum of a master’s degree with 18 graduate semester hours (or 30 quarter hours) in the teaching discipline.
Preferred Qualifications- Terminal degree in the teaching discipline
- 1-year college-level teaching
- Sustained professional engagement that demonstrates relevance and currency in the field of teaching
